the measurement of metal-fluoride ion association in aqueous solutions of constant ionic strength, with a calomel reference electrode and sodium chloride salt bridge. Measurements were made with magnesium, calcium, scandium, iron(III), europium(III) and gadolinium ions at 25°; yttrium and “protonation” of [F - ] were studied at 15, 25 and 35° and enthalpy and entropy changes calculated.
